Potcast 223: Pediatric Medical Cannabis

We’re exploring pediatric medical cannabis with Dr. Ann-Marie Wong, Miami’s #1 medical marijuana doctor prescribing cannabinoids as a treatment for pediatric care. If you have littles in your life with aggression and possible screen addiction, I created this potcast for you. It’s also for parents exploring medical cannabis options to treat your child’s autism, cancer, epilepsy, chronic pain, and more.
